摘要:MySQL计划任务事件是一种非常有用的功能,它可以帮助我们在特定时间或特定条件下自动执行一些操作,从而提高工作效率。本文将介绍MySQL计划任务事件的设置方法。
1. 创建事件
要创建MySQL计划任务事件,我们需要使用CREATE EVENT语句。我们要创建一个每天晚上10点执行的事件,可以使用以下语句:
yevent
ON SCHEDULE EVERY 1 DAY
STARTS '2022-01-01 22:00:00'
BEGIN
-- 执行操作
yevent的事件,它将在每天晚上10点触发。我们可以在STARTS子句中指定事件的开始日期和时间。
2. 修改事件
如果我们需要修改已有的MySQL计划任务事件,可以使用ALTER EVENT语句。我们要将之前创建的事件改为每周一晚上10点执行,可以使用以下语句:
yevent
ON SCHEDULE EVERY 1 WEEK
STARTS '2022-01-03 22:00:00';
在这个例子中,我们将事件的执行频率改为每周一次,并将开始时间改为2022年1月3日晚上10点。
3. 删除事件
如果我们需要删除MySQL计划任务事件,可以使用DROP EVENT语句。我们要删除之前创建的事件,可以使用以下语句:
yevent;
yevent的事件将被删除。
总结:MySQL计划任务事件可以帮助我们自动执行一些操作,从而提高工作效率。我们可以使用CREATE EVENT语句创建事件,使用ALTER EVENT语句修改事件,使用DROP EVENT语句删除事件。